  • Instances - definition of instances by The Free Dictionary
    1 a case or occurrence of something: fresh instances of oppression 2 an example put forth in proof or illustration: to cite a few instances 3 the institution and prosecution of a legal case 4 Archaic urgency in speech or action

  • Instance - Definition, Meaning Synonyms | Vocabulary. com
    An instance is a specific example or case of something One instance of being chased by a growling dog can make a person spend his whole life being afraid of animals It's common to find instance used in the expression "for instance," meaning "for example "
